Statement about the Liberty Protection Safeguards

Source: Skills For Care In May 2019, the Mental Capacity (Amendment) Act became law, and replaces the Deprivation of Liberty Safeguards (DoLS) with a new scheme known as the Liberty Protection Safeguards (LPS). There is a national group working to develop a Code of...
